What is the salary of Navy SSR?

The officers will receive around Rs. when they are assigned to Level 3 of the Defence Pay Matrix. Between 21,700 and 69,100 per month. The initial training period has a salary of about Rs. 14,600 per month is how much it costs. 2000 vacancies will be filled by the SSR and 500 by the AA.

What is AA in Navy?

Artificer apprentices receive the best technical training to hold highly responsible positions in the Indian Navy.
